Slow Cooker Carolina BBQ

A perfect Carolina pulled pork recipe. Grab a slow cooker for a big pork shoulder, cider vinegar, and pepper sauce to bring Carolina to your kitchen.

Preparation Time
15 mins
Cooking Time
12 hr
Total Time
12 hr 15 mins
Calories
293 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Place pork shoulder into a slow cooker and season with salt and pepper. Pour vinegar around the pork. Cover, and cook on Low for 12 hours. Pork should easily pull apart into strands.
Step 2
Remove pork from the slow cooker and discard any bones. Strain off the liquid, reserving 2 cups (discard any extra). Shred pork using tongs or two forks, and return to the slow cooker.
Step 3
Stir brown sugar, hot pepper sauce, cayenne pepper, and red pepper flakes into the reserved liquid. Mix into pork in the slow cooker.
Step 4
Cover and keep on Low setting until serving.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oons cayenne pepper
  • 2 teaspoons crushed red pepper flakes
  • 1 tablespoon kosher salt
  • 1 (5 pound) bone-in pork shoulder roast
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ground black pepper, or to taste
  • 1.5 cups apple cider vinegar
  • 1.5 tablespoons hot pepper sauce
